Knowledge Evidence

Individuals must be able to demonstrate knowledge of:

work health and safety (WHS), and occupational health and safety (OHS) requirements relating to carrying out basic GMAW, including procedures for:

selecting and using personal protective equipment (PPE) when working with GMAW equipment, including approved welding helmet

using specialist welding tools and equipment

using protective screens and fume extraction system

manually handling components and GMAW equipment

identifying and controlling hazards

environmental requirements, including procedures for trapping, storing and disposing of waste materials

hazards associated with GMAW, including:

arc eye and exposure to ultraviolet light

molten metal spatter and fire danger

GMAW principles, including:

process of using an electric arc to melt and join metal

basic construction and operation of welding gun and wire feed unit

types and application of welding wire and shielding gases

properties and characteristics of metals to be welded

types of welds, including:

butt welds

fillet welds

tee joints

corner joints

procedures for protecting vehicle electronics during welding

GMAW procedures, including:

component cleaning and preparation

welder current and voltage settings, gas flow rates, wire diameters and wire feed speed

wire stick out distance, gun angle between the work pieces and travel angle

weld testing procedures, including non-destructive testing

post-weld inspection procedures including, weld defects.
